Q Television Network was a shortlived American cable television channel which aired programming targeted to the lesbian, gay, and bisexual audiences. Founded by Frank Olsen, and eventually owned by Triangle Multimedia, the cable channel aired a mix of film, documentary and music programming, along with a number of original live talk show, information and news programs.
